Fulham boss Martin Jol denies there's any rift with Bobby Zamora.
Jol has rubbished his reputation as a bully boss as stories of a row with Zamora rumble on.
"I tell the truth. I am not a bully," Jol said.
"That is not my style but I want to win and sometimes I have to visualise that with the players. I am not the sort of manager that shouts, the only thing I can do is exclude them or drop them. If they don't work 100 per cent for the team I don't think I will shout at them or fine them, I don't think that will help with all the players. That can be a strength or a weakness.
"I've not had a row with Zamora, but I know where stories are coming from."
